Main Page   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Namespace Members   Compound Members   File Members   Related Pages  

ComputeOccupancyMap_t Struct Reference

List of all members.

Public Attributes

float * map
int mx
int my
int mz
float lx
float ly
float lz
float x0
float y0
float z0
float ax [3]
float ay [3]
float az [3]
float alignmat [16]
int num_coords
const float * coords
const int * vdw_type
const float * vdw_params
const float * probe_vdw_params
const float * conformers
int num_probes
int num_conformers
float cutoff
float extcutoff
float excl_dist
float excl_energy
int kstart
int kstop
float hx
float hy
float hz
float bx
float by
float bz
float bx_1
float by_1
float bz_1
int mpblx
int mpbly
int mpblz
int cpu_only
BinOfAtomsbin
BinOfAtomsbin_zero
char * bincnt
char * bincnt_zero
int nbx
int nby
int nbz
int padx
int pady
int padz
char * bin_offsets
int num_bin_offsets
AtomPosTypeextra
int num_extras
char * exclusions

Member Data Documentation

float ComputeOccupancyMap_t::alignmat[16]
 

Definition at line 77 of file VolMapCreateILS.C.

float ComputeOccupancyMap_t::ax[3]
 

Definition at line 76 of file VolMapCreateILS.C.

float ComputeOccupancyMap_t::ay[3]
 

Definition at line 76 of file VolMapCreateILS.C.

float ComputeOccupancyMap_t::az[3]
 

Definition at line 76 of file VolMapCreateILS.C.

BinOfAtoms* ComputeOccupancyMap_t::bin
 

Definition at line 116 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_cleanup, ComputeOccupancyMap_setup, and fill_atom_bins.

char* ComputeOccupancyMap_t::bin_offsets
 

Definition at line 124 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_cleanup, ComputeOccupancyMap_setup, find_energy_exclusions, and tighten_bin_neighborhood.

BinOfAtoms* ComputeOccupancyMap_t::bin_zero
 

Definition at line 117 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

char* ComputeOccupancyMap_t::bincnt
 

Definition at line 118 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_cleanup, ComputeOccupancyMap_setup, fill_atom_bins, and write_bin_histogram_map.

char* ComputeOccupancyMap_t::bincnt_zero
 

Definition at line 119 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_setup, and fill_atom_bins.

float ComputeOccupancyMap_t::bx
 

Definition at line 111 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, tighten_bin_neighborhood, and write_bin_histogram_map.

float ComputeOccupancyMap_t::bx_1
 

Definition at line 112 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::by
 

Definition at line 111 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, tighten_bin_neighborhood, and write_bin_histogram_map.

float ComputeOccupancyMap_t::by_1
 

Definition at line 112 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::bz
 

Definition at line 111 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, tighten_bin_neighborhood, and write_bin_histogram_map.

float ComputeOccupancyMap_t::bz_1
 

Definition at line 112 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

const float* ComputeOccupancyMap_t::conformers
 

Definition at line 90 of file VolMapCreateILS.C.

Referenced by compute_occupancy_multiatom.

const float* ComputeOccupancyMap_t::coords
 

Definition at line 79 of file VolMapCreateILS.C.

Referenced by fill_atom_bins.

int ComputeOccupancyMap_t::cpu_only
 

Definition at line 114 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_setup.

float ComputeOccupancyMap_t::cutoff
 

Definition at line 97 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, and find_energy_exclusions.

float ComputeOccupancyMap_t::excl_dist
 

Definition at line 100 of file VolMapCreateILS.C.

Referenced by find_distance_exclusions.

float ComputeOccupancyMap_t::excl_energy
 

Definition at line 101 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, and find_energy_exclusions.

char* ComputeOccupancyMap_t::exclusions
 

Definition at line 130 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_calculate_slab, ComputeOccupancyMap_cleanup,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::extcutoff
 

Definition at line 98 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, fill_atom_bins, and tighten_bin_neighborhood.

AtomPosType* ComputeOccupancyMap_t::extra
 

Definition at line 127 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_cleanup, ComputeOccupancyMap_setup,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::hx
 

Definition at line 110 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::hy
 

Definition at line 110 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::hz
 

Definition at line 110 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

int ComputeOccupancyMap_t::kstart
 

Definition at line 103 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, find_distance_exclusions, and find_energy_exclusions.

int ComputeOccupancyMap_t::kstop
 

Definition at line 103 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, find_distance_exclusions, and find_energy_exclusions.

float ComputeOccupancyMap_t::lx
 

Definition at line 74 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, and fill_atom_bins.

float ComputeOccupancyMap_t::ly
 

Definition at line 74 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, and fill_atom_bins.

float ComputeOccupancyMap_t::lz
 

Definition at line 74 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, ComputeOccupancyMap_setup, and fill_atom_bins.

float* ComputeOccupancyMap_t::map
 

Definition at line 72 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, and ComputeOccupancyMap_setup.

int ComputeOccupancyMap_t::mpblx
 

Definition at line 113 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_setup.

int ComputeOccupancyMap_t::mpbly
 

Definition at line 113 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_setup.

int ComputeOccupancyMap_t::mpblz
 

Definition at line 113 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_setup.

int ComputeOccupancyMap_t::mx
 

Definition at line 73 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_calculate_slab,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

int ComputeOccupancyMap_t::my
 

Definition at line 73 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, ComputeOccupancyMap_calculate_slab, ComputeOccupancyMap_setup, find_distance_exclusions, and find_energy_exclusions.

int ComputeOccupancyMap_t::mz
 

Definition at line 73 of file VolMapCreateILS.C.

Referenced by ComputeOccupancyMap_calculate_slab, and ComputeOccupancyMap_setup.

int ComputeOccupancyMap_t::nbx
 

Definition at line 121 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, find_energy_exclusions, and write_bin_histogram_map.

int ComputeOccupancyMap_t::nby
 

Definition at line 121 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, find_energy_exclusions, and write_bin_histogram_map.

int ComputeOccupancyMap_t::nbz
 

Definition at line 121 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, fill_atom_bins, and write_bin_histogram_map.

int ComputeOccupancyMap_t::num_bin_offsets
 

Definition at line 125 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, find_energy_exclusions, and tighten_bin_neighborhood.

int ComputeOccupancyMap_t::num_conformers
 

Definition at line 95 of file VolMapCreateILS.C.

Referenced by compute_occupancy_multiatom.

int ComputeOccupancyMap_t::num_coords
 

Definition at line 78 of file VolMapCreateILS.C.

Referenced by fill_atom_bins.

int ComputeOccupancyMap_t::num_extras
 

Definition at line 128 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, and find_energy_exclusions.

int ComputeOccupancyMap_t::num_probes
 

Definition at line 94 of file VolMapCreateILS.C.

Referenced by compute_occupancy_multiatom, and ComputeOccupancyMap_calculate_slab.

int ComputeOccupancyMap_t::padx
 

Definition at line 122 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, fill_atom_bins, tighten_bin_neighborhood, and write_bin_histogram_map.

int ComputeOccupancyMap_t::pady
 

Definition at line 122 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, fill_atom_bins, tighten_bin_neighborhood, and write_bin_histogram_map.

int ComputeOccupancyMap_t::padz
 

Definition at line 122 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, fill_atom_bins, tighten_bin_neighborhood, and write_bin_histogram_map.

const float* ComputeOccupancyMap_t::probe_vdw_params
 

Definition at line 86 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, and find_energy_exclusions.

const float* ComputeOccupancyMap_t::vdw_params
 

Definition at line 83 of file VolMapCreateILS.C.

Referenced by compute_occupancy_monoatom, compute_occupancy_multiatom, and find_energy_exclusions.

const int* ComputeOccupancyMap_t::vdw_type
 

Definition at line 81 of file VolMapCreateILS.C.

Referenced by fill_atom_bins.

float ComputeOccupancyMap_t::x0
 

Definition at line 75 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, find_energy_exclusions, and write_bin_histogram_map.

float ComputeOccupancyMap_t::y0
 

Definition at line 75 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, find_energy_exclusions, and write_bin_histogram_map.

float ComputeOccupancyMap_t::z0
 

Definition at line 75 of file VolMapCreateILS.C.

Referenced by atom_bin_stats, compute_occupancy_monoatom, compute_occupancy_multiatom, fill_atom_bins, find_distance_exclusions, find_energy_exclusions, and write_bin_histogram_map.


The documentation for this struct was generated from the following file:
Generated on Wed Apr 24 02:44:46 2024 for VMD (current) by doxygen1.2.14 written by Dimitri van Heesch, © 1997-2002